Ringing one of your friends using speed dial is easy – you can assign a number to nine of your friends, and then simply bring up the onscreen keyboard, hold down one of the numbers and your Nokia N8 will ring that person.
To set up speed dialling, press the menu button, and then press Settings. Click on Calling, and then it's a simple case of pressing Speed Dialling. This brings up the number 1-9, in a large onscreen keypad.
Pick the number you want to assign a contact to, and this will bring up your contacts list. Pick a person, and they'll appear where the number was. Once you've finished, press the menu or back button to exit.
To use speed dial, press call to bring up the onscreen keyboard, pick the number of the friend you want to ring, and then hold that number until the phone starts to ring. Easy!
